Output 643d5e0aa8f4ea82facac260dfd33de2e2b738470c360b2ac4bc0aff0f0e6194:1

value
39450815
script pubkey
OP_0 OP_PUSHBYTES_32 518395f253901b309b0da3b4e485c6742eefc7b03fd8a772682ed9174049ed00
address
bc1q2xpetujnjqdnpxcd5w6wfpwxwshwl3as8lv2wung9mv3wszfa5qqmkgeav
transaction
643d5e0aa8f4ea82facac260dfd33de2e2b738470c360b2ac4bc0aff0f0e6194
confirmations
24369
spent
true